2026 最新版 OpenClaw 实操指南:从安装部署、自定义 Skills 开发、自动化任务配置到多 Agent 管理一站式全解
什么是 OpenClaw?为什么值得关注?
OpenClaw 是一款可本地部署的开源 AI 智能体,支持在笔记本、家用服务器或云端 VPS 运行。区别于仅能对话应答的网页端 AI 工具,OpenClaw 具备自主执行能力:可读取邮件、安排日程、整理文件,还能通过 WhatsApp、Telegram、Discord 发送消息,用自然语言实现重复工作流自动化。
自 2025 年 11 月发布至今,该项目 GitHub 星标已突破 295 万,成为开源社区增长最快的仓库之一。核心原因很简单:用户需要能落地执行的 AI 助手,而非仅提供方案的对话工具。
与传统 AI 聊天机器人直观对比
传统 AI 聊天机器人:
你:“帮我整理桌面文件。”
AI:“好的!建议如下:1. 按类型新建文件夹…2. 分类移动文件…”
OpenClaw:
你:“帮我整理桌面文件。”
OpenClaw:完成 47 个文件重命名、分类,归入 5 个文件夹 ——“已按文件类型整理完毕!”
这正是从聊天机器人到 AI 智能体的核心变革。
本指南将带你完整上手 OpenClaw,从首次安装、自定义技能开发到多智能体管理全覆盖,无论你有 30 分钟还是一整天,都能按节奏逐步学习。
原文地址:OpenClaw 从入门到精通:零基础安装到进阶实战全指南
入门:安装与设置
前置要求
- Node.js 22+(推荐 LTS 版本), 使用
node --version检查 - AI 模型 API Key —— Anthropic Claude(推荐)、OpenAI 或通过 Ollama 运行的本地模型
- macOS、Linux 或 Windows(需 WSL2)
安装 OpenClaw
最快的方式是使用一行命令安装:
curl -fsSL https://openclaw.ai/install.sh | bash
该命令会检测你的系统,按需安装依赖,并启动设置向导。如果你更喜欢使用 npm:
npm install -g openclaw@latest
Docker 用户可以使用:
docker pull openclaw/openclaw:latest
docker run -d --name openclaw \
-v ~/.openclaw:/root/.openclaw \
openclaw/openclaw:latest
有关每种安装方式的详细步骤,请参阅我们的快速入门指南。
运行引导向导
安装完成后,引导向导会带你完成所有配置:
openclaw onboard
你需要配置以下三项内容:
- AI 提供商和 API Key —— Anthropic Claude 效果最佳。如果你还没有 API Key,可以在 anthropic.com 获取。预算有限?请参阅我们的模型选择与费用指南。
- 消息渠道 —— 至少选择一个:Telegram 最容易上手(5 分钟即可设置)。我们为 Telegram、WhatsApp 和 Discord 提供了专门的教程。
- 安全模式 —— 目前选择 Sandbox 即可。等你熟悉后,可以升级为完全访问权限。
验证是否正常运行
openclaw status
你应该看到:
Gateway: Running ✓
Model: Connected ✓
Channels: 1 active
现在打开你选择的消息应用,发送第一条消息。试试简单的指令:
- "你能做什么?"
- "现在几点了?"
- "总结一下最新的科技新闻。"
如果机器人回复了,恭喜——你已经拥有了一个可以工作的 AI Agent。
核心概念:OpenClaw 工作原理拆解
深入探索前,先掌握 OpenClaw 的四大核心模块,理解起来更轻松:
Gateway —— 全能接入门
作为 OpenClaw 与外部场景的连接枢纽,Gateway 可无缝对接 Telegram、Discord、WhatsApp、Web API 及命令行等多渠道消息。你能同时启用多个 Gateway:比如 Telegram 处理个人事务,Slack 对接工作沟通。
Skills —— 实用技能库
Skills 对应 OpenClaw 的核心功能,每个 Skill 都是一款独立工具:发送邮件、网页搜索、文件管理、浏览器控制等,就像智能手机里的实用应用。OpenClaw 自带基础 Skills,而 Clawhub 社区生态的海量资源,以及自定义编写的专属 Skills,才是其强大能力的关键。
浏览 Skills 目录 查看全部可用功能。
Memory —— 智能记忆库
OpenClaw 具备跨对话记忆能力,你告知的姓名、工作时间、偏好设置等信息,都会被持续保存为上下文。不同于无状态聊天机器人,它能逐步建立对用户身份与工作习惯的深度理解,所有数据均存储在本地~/.openclaw/memory/ 目录,安全可控。
Sandbox —— 安全防护墙
Sandbox 负责管控 OpenClaw 在系统中的操作权限,开启后可限制其访问任意文件或执行高危命令。这层核心安全防线,在尝试新 Skills 或赋予软件更广泛权限时,能有效规避风险。
查看安全配置模板 了解详细安全设置。
Skills 安装与使用教程
Skills 是让 OpenClaw 从 “趣味演示工具” 升级为 “实用日常工具” 的核心功能,下面为你带来完整入门指南。
浏览与安装
# 按关键词搜索 Skills openclaw skills search email # 查看指定 Skill 详情 openclaw skills info @openclaw/email-manager # 安装对应 Skill openclaw skills install @openclaw/email-manager
推荐优先安装的 5 个 Skills
| Skill | 功能说明 | 安装命令 |
| Email Manager | 邮件阅读、撰写与发送 | openclaw skills install @openclaw/email-manager |
| Calendar | 新建日程、查看行程、发送邀请 | openclaw skills install @openclaw/calendar |
| File Organizer | 文件整理、重命名与清理 | openclaw skills install @openclaw/file-organizer |
| Web Search | 网页搜索与内容总结 | openclaw skills install @openclaw/tavily-search |
| Browser Control | 浏览器操作自动化 | openclaw plugins install @openclaw/browser-control |
安装完成后,直接用自然语言与你的 Agent 交互即可:
- “帮我查看未读邮件,总结前三封内容。”
- “我明天的日程有哪些?”
- “搜索最新版 OpenClaw 发布说明。”
Skills 管理命令
# 查看已安装的所有 Skills openclaw skills list # 一键更新全部 Skills openclaw skills update # 卸载不常用 Skill openclaw skills remove @openclaw/file-organizer
安装第三方 Skills 前,建议查阅官方 Skills 安全检查清单,保障使用安全。
设置自动化任务(定时任务)
OpenClaw 核心实用功能之一便是定时自动化,无需每日手动触发 Agent 执行操作,一次设置即可实现自动运行。
创建每日简报
仅需通过自然语言向你的 Agent 下达指令:
“每天早上 8 点,为我推送一份简报,包含当日天气、日历事项及未读邮件数量。”
OpenClaw 即可自动生成定时任务,你也可手动进行管理:
# 列出所有定时任务 openclaw cron list # 查看指定任务详情 openclaw cron show <task-id> # 暂停任务 openclaw cron disable <task-id> # 恢复任务 openclaw cron enable <task-id> # 永久删除任务 openclaw cron delete <task-id>
自动化应用场景
- 每日简报:每日早晨同步天气、日程、未读邮件
- 每周总结:周五下午汇总本周工作动态
- 价格监控:实时监测商品价格,降价即刻提醒
- 下班提示:每晚 6 点温馨提醒结束工作
- 收件箱整理:每晚自动归档低优先级邮件
配置持久化记忆功能
OpenClaw 的记忆系统赋予其个性化交互能力,你提供的上下文信息越丰富,它的服务就越贴合你的需求。
让智能助手更懂你
你只需发送指令,即可让助手快速记住你的信息:
“记住关于我的这些信息:我叫 Alex。我是一名产品经理。我的工作时间是周一到周五,上午 9 点到下午 6 点,时区 GMT+8。我喜欢简洁的回复。我用英语交流,但也能读中文。”
OpenClaw 会自动将这些信息存入长期记忆库,并在后续所有对话中持续应用。
查看与编辑记忆内容
# 查看智能助手已保存的记忆信息 cat ~/.openclaw/memory/long-term.json
你也可以在对话中直接询问:“你了解我哪些信息?”
同时支持随时更正或删除记忆,例如:
“忘掉我之前的工作时间。我现在的工作时间是上午 10 点到晚上 7 点。”
记忆系统运行原理
OpenClaw 采用三层记忆架构:
- 短期记忆:当前对话上下文,会话结束后自动清除
- 长期记忆:个人持久化信息,包含偏好、习惯、个人资料
- 情景记忆:历史交互记录,用于精准识别使用模式
分层记忆设计让智能助手越用越智能,无需反复重复个人信息。
从零编写你的第一个自定义 Skill
当系统内置与社区现有 Skill 无法满足你的个性化需求时,你可以自主开发。OpenClaw Skill 采用简洁易懂的 YAML 格式编写。
Skill 基础结构
在路径 ~/.openclaw/skills/daily-news.yaml 新建配置文件:
name: "Daily Tech News" description: "Fetches and summarizes today's top tech headlines" version: "1.0.0" triggers: - "tech news" - "today's news" - "news summary" steps: - action: web_search query: "top tech news today" max_results: 5 - action: summarize content: "{{search_results}}" style: "bullet_points" - action: respond message: | Here's your tech news summary: {{summary}}
快速测试方法
# 重新加载Skill使新配置生效 openclaw skills reload # 直接测试指定Skill openclaw skills test "Daily Tech News"
测试完成后,在对话中直接输入:给我今天的科技新闻即可使用。
打造高阶复杂 Skill
Skill 支持多动作串联执行,可自由组合实现复杂流程:
- web_search — 网页信息检索
- summarize — 文本浓缩与摘要生成
- respond — 格式化内容回复
- file_read /file_write — 文件读写操作
- shell_exec — Shell 命令执行(需对应权限)
- http_request — 外部 API 接口调用
你可通过组合上述能力搭建完整工作流,例如:查询机票价格→数据对比→摘要写入文件→Telegram 自动推送。
多 Agent 智能管理
随着使用场景不断丰富,你可针对生活、工作、实验等不同需求,创建专属独立 Agent—— 工作专用 Agent、个人生活 Agent、实验测试 Agent,实现场景化智能分工。
创建 Agent
创建搭载 Claude Sonnet 的工作专用 Agent
openclaw create-agent work
openclaw config --agent work set ai.model "claude-sonnet-4-6"
创建个人生活专属 Agent
openclaw create-agent personal
openclaw config --agent personal set ai.model "claude-haiku-4-5"
查看全部已创建 Agent
openclaw list-agents
快速切换不同 Agent
openclaw switch-agent work
为何选择多 Agent 架构?
| Agent | 模型 | 连接渠道 | 核心用途 |
| Work | Claude Sonnet | Slack、Gmail、Linear | 专业办公、邮件智能处理 |
| Personal | Claude Haiku | Telegram、Google Calendar | 日程规划、事项提醒、个人事务管理 |
| Lab | Ollama(本地部署) | 仅限命令行 | 新技能测试、功能实验 |
每个 Agent 均搭载独立 Memory、Skills 与渠道连接配置,数据与权限完全隔离,使用更安全、分工更清晰。
浏览器自动化
OpenClaw 可实现浏览器深度控制,执行远超常规 API 调用的复杂操作:自动填写表单、精准抓取网页数据、跨平台商品比价、页面一键截图。
启用 Browser Control
安装浏览器插件
openclaw plugins install @openclaw/browser-control
启用浏览器控制
openclaw config set browser.enabled true
显示浏览器窗口(true 为调试模式)
openclaw config set browser.headless false
实用场景
“打开 GitHub,查看当日热门趋势仓库。”
“打开 Amazon,搜索机械键盘,筛选评分前三商品并展示对应价格。”
“在 example.com 使用个人信息自动填写联系表单。”
“对个人作品官网进行页面截图。”
浏览器自动化功能强大,但资源占用较高。建议仅在需要可视化交互的场景中使用;简单数据获取,推荐使用 Web Search Skill,效率更高、成本更低。
超越聊天的全能集成
OpenClaw 不止连接各类通讯应用,热门集成场景包括:
Google Workspace
openclaw config set integrations.google.enabled true
openclaw config set integrations.google.credentialsPath "/path/to/credentials.json"
openclaw integrations google authorize
完成连接后,你可借助自然语言轻松管理 Gmail、Google 日历与 Google 云端硬盘。
项目管理(Linear、Jira)
openclaw skills install @openclaw/linear
openclaw config set integrations.linear.apiKey "YOUR_API_KEY"
"在 Linear 新建高优先级任务:修复登录页面重定向 Bug。"
笔记应用(Obsidian、Notion)
openclaw skills install @openclaw/obsidian
openclaw config set integrations.obsidian.vaultPath "/path/to/vault"
"在 Obsidian 创建标题为《Meeting Notes — March 2》的新笔记,记录当日会议核心内容。"
完整支持平台清单,可查阅官方渠道集成目录。
安全防护与费用管控
Docker 沙箱安全隔离
想要实现极致隔离效果,可在 Docker Sandbox 环境中运行 OpenClaw:
openclaw config set sandbox.mode "docker" openclaw config set sandbox.docker.image "openclaw/sandbox:latest" openclaw sandbox test
该操作可将文件系统访问、网络权限与 Shell 执行操作,严格限制在预设安全范围内。
执行安全审计
openclaw security audit --deep
执行此命令,可自动检测权限配置异常、令牌泄露等常见安全风险。
完整安全加固方案,可查阅端口暴露与远程访问官方指南。
智能费用管控
API 调用费用易持续累积,通过以下指令快速设置费用防护:
# 配置每日请求上限 openclaw config set ai.dailyLimit 1000 # 配置月度预算上限(单位:美元) openclaw config set ai.monthlyBudget 50 # 查询使用数据 openclaw stats usage openclaw stats cost
月度费用参考
| 使用等级 | 适用场景 | 预估费用 |
| 轻度 | 每日 10-20 次对话 | $5–10 / 月 |
| 中度 | 每日 50-100 次对话 + 定时任务 | $20–30 / 月 |
| 重度 | 自动化操作 + 浏览器控制 | $50–100 / 月 |
想获取更精准的费用优化方案,可参考模型选择与费用指南。
故障排除速查表
| 症状 | 可能原因 | 解决方法 |
| 启动提示 EADDRINUSE | 端口 18789 被占用 | openclaw gateway start --port 18790 |
| 提示 401 Unauthorized | API Key 无效或已过期 | openclaw config set api-key |
| 机器人无响应 | 渠道未正常连接 | 执行 openclaw status 并检查渠道配置 |
| 响应速度慢 | 模型过载或网络异常 | 更换轻量模型或排查网络连接 |
| Skills 未加载 | 安装后未重新加载 | openclaw skills reload |
更多故障解决方案,可查阅官方常见错误指南。
实用诊断命令
# 全面健康检查 openclaw doctor # 查看运行日志 openclaw logs # 开启调试模式 openclaw config set logging.level "debug"
OpenClaw 革新 AI 交互模式,从获取建议升级为委派实际任务。项目持续迭代,社区日益壮大,现在即可搭建专属 AI Agent 系统。
写到最后
现在各大云平台都已经支持这个OpenClaw智能体,适合希望快速部署免去本地环境调试麻烦的团队和个人;如果不想安装在本机,可以一键部署云上OpenClaw:
阿里云一键部署:稳定不贵,不写代码,分钟级部署OpenClaw